    This issue features an ad with the first in-print mention of The Flash and Hawkman, pre-dating publication of Flash Comics #1! Cover art by Walter Galli, Jon L. Blummer, and William Smith. Origin, Part II starring Gary Concord, the Ultra-Man, script and art by Jon L. Blummer (signed as Don Shelby); Gary's father's story continues; He discovers he is the only one who can breathe the air outside the domed cities. Mutt and Jeff strips by Al Smith (as Bud Fisher). Believe It or Not by Robert L. Ripley. The Volcano starring Red, White and Blue, art by William Smith. Northern Lights starring Hop Harrigan, script and art by Jon L. Blummer (signed as Jon Elby). A Thousand Years A Minute - Part 3--Adventures in the Unknown, script by Carl H. Claudy, art by Stan Aschmeier. Scribbly Teaches the Principal, script and art by Sheldon Mayer. Calling the Roll starring Ben Webster, script and art by Edwin Alger. The American Way [Part 4], script by John B. Wentworth, art by Walter Galli. 68 pgs. $0.10. Cover price $0.10.

    Cover art by Irwin Hasen. The Icicle starring Green Lantern, script by Robert Kanigher, pencils: by Irwin Hasen, inks by John Belfi; The arrival of a foreign physicist with a new secret invention capable of instantly freezing any moisture in the air also heralds the arrival of a new foe for the Emerald Crusader: the Icicle! The Haunted Chessboard starring Dr. Mid-Nite, pencils by Arthur F. Peddy, inks by Bernard Sachs. The Land of Little Men starring The Black Pirate, art by Paul Reinman. Mystery of the Royal Blue Jet starring Hop Harrigan, art by Howard Purcell. Mutt and Jeff strips by Al Smith [signed as Bud Fisher]. 52 pgs. $0.10. Cover price $0.10.
